calculate the taxes owed for the following situations. You must show your work

  1. Samantha is single with a taxable income of $215,230. How much does she owe in taxes? What is her marginal tax rate? What is her average tax rate?
  2. Brandy and Ike are married with 8 children. Their combined taxable income is $652,000. How much do they owe in taxes? What is their marginal tax rate? What is their average tax rate?
  3. Sellah is a single mother with a taxable income of 85,000. She had $8,250 withheld from her paychecks throughout 2019. How much does she still owe the IRS for 2019 or will she receive a refund?image text in transcribed
